Common issues with aging AC systems
-
Aging air conditioning systems gradually lose efficiency due to worn components, refrigerant leaks, and accumulated dirt that force equipment to work harder while providing less cooling output. We identify efficiency decline through performance testing and energy consumption analysis, which compares current operation with the original manufacturer's specifications. Declining efficiency often indicates that replacement will provide better long-term value than continued repairs, particularly when monthly energy costs increase significantly despite regular maintenance efforts.
-
Air conditioning systems requiring multiple service calls each season typically suffer from cascading component failures that indicate approaching end-of-life conditions requiring complete system replacement. We track repair frequency and costs to help property owners determine when replacement becomes more economical than continued maintenance expenses. Frequent failures disrupt comfort during the peak cooling season, while generating unexpected expenses that often exceed the cost of proactive replacement with reliable, modern equipment.
-
Aging systems that fail to maintain consistent temperatures or provide adequate airflow often suffer from fundamental capacity problems, ductwork deterioration, or component wear that replacement addresses comprehensively. We investigate comfort complaints systematically to determine whether equipment limitations, distribution problems, or system design issues contribute to poor performance. Replacing equipment with properly sized units often resolves persistent comfort issues while improving efficiency and reliability throughout Albuquerque properties.
-
Strange sounds or smells from air conditioning equipment indicate mechanical problems, electrical issues, or component deterioration that threatens safe operation and reliable cooling performance. We investigate noise and odor complaints to identify failing components, burnt electrical connections, or refrigerant leaks that require immediate attention or system replacement. These warning signs often precede major failures that can damage property or create safety hazards, making prompt evaluation and replacement consideration essential for continued safe operation.

FAQs about AC Replacement in Albuquerque
-
Air conditioning systems in Albuquerque typically operate effectively for twelve to eighteen years, depending on equipment quality, maintenance frequency, and usage patterns throughout the region's extended cooling season. We consider factors like system age, efficiency ratings, repair history, and refrigerant type when evaluating replacement timing for optimal value and reliability. Regular maintenance extends equipment life, while harsh desert conditions, frequent usage, and dust exposure can accelerate wear, making professional evaluation important for replacement planning.
-
We evaluate repair versus replacement decisions by comparing annual repair costs, system age, efficiency ratings, and remaining component life to determine the most cost-effective solution. Systems requiring repairs exceeding fifty percent of replacement cost or showing multiple component failures typically benefit from replacement rather than continued maintenance expenses. Age, efficiency, and reliability considerations help property owners make informed decisions that balance immediate costs with long-term performance and operating economics.
-
Proper air conditioning sizing requires professional load calculations that consider square footage, insulation levels, window orientations, ceiling heights, and occupancy patterns specific to each Albuquerque property. We perform detailed evaluations using industry-standard methods that account for local climate conditions, solar heat gain, and architectural features affecting cooling requirements. Correctly sized equipment provides optimal comfort, efficiency, and humidity control while avoiding problems associated with oversized or undersized installations that waste energy or result in poor performance.
-
Most residential air conditioning replacements require one to three days, depending on system complexity, electrical requirements, ductwork modifications, and site-specific conditions throughout Albuquerque installations. We complete straightforward replacements using existing connections and locations within one day, while installations requiring electrical upgrades, ductwork changes, or structural modifications may take longer. Our replacement teams work efficiently to minimize disruption while completing thorough testing and commissioning that validates proper operation before project completion.
